If you think grace is waiting in a pew with its arms crossed, you've been lied to. Backsliders & Beloved is for the ones who slipped out quietly—the disillusioned, burned-out, or just plain tired—who still hum worship songs in traffic but can't force a smile on Sundays. With the blunt honesty of a friend and the steadiness of a pastor, D. Michael Gross reframes the gospel as a search party, not a performance review. This is not a pep talk, and it's not parole. It's the scandalous claim that the Shepherd doesn't update the locks or the guest list when you wander; He puts on His battered boots and comes after you. Across short, potent chapters, Gross dismantles religious score-keeping (your name is kept), the myth of "cheap grace" (He pays the cost again), and the paralyzing fear that you must carry your own weight back to God (the first step is being carried). The tone is Protestant, biblical, and deeply humane—written for church-hurt Christians, exvangelicals, and anyone suspicious of religious sales pitches.
